Why WordPress and CRM belong together

WordPress currently anchors the digital presence for several Quincy services. It's versatile, cost-effective, and has a deep plugin community. A CRM takes you from anonymous internet website traffic to called contacts with history, choices, and ownership. Connecting them transforms a fixed sales brochure right into a sales and service engine.

Three results stand apart. Initially, instant lead capture that never ever gets shed in somebody's inbox. Second, lifecycle tracking that links a first click on your "Obtain a Quote" page to the authorized agreement or set up appointment. Third, targeted follow-ups, not spray-and-pray emails. As opposed to a generic blast, the roofing business pushes storm-damaged communities, the med health club supplies new-patient packages, and the realty group sends out a listing absorb customized to a certain rate band.

For this to function, the site has to run quickly. Site speed-optimized advancement isn't window dressing. The minute a kind lags, individuals bounce, analytics alter, and your ads waste cash money. I've seen 0.8 to 1.4 2nd gains in Largest Contentful Paint by dumping puffed up web page contractors, compressing hero photos, and lazy-loading third-party manuscripts after consent. Those secs translate to form conclusions, specifically on mobile.

Choosing a CRM that fits your company, not the other way around

There's no one-size solution. HubSpot and Salesforce control nationwide discussions, however the most effective option depends upon group size, sales cycle, compliance, and assimilation spending plan. I motivate proprietors to evaluate by 3 standards: exactly how it handles calls and bargains, exactly how it incorporates with WordPress without air duct tape, and whether your personnel can run it without creating faster ways that break data integrity.

Let's ground this in local verticals.

  • Contractor/ Roof Websites: You need robust lead routing, solution area mapping, and job-stage presence. JobNimbus and AccuLynx were built for this world. HubSpot can function if you customize pipes: Prospect, Evaluation Scheduled, Price Quote Sent, Won, Production. The important combination pieces are form-to-pipeline mapping, picture upload for hail storm or wind damages, and SMS for appointment confirmations.
  • Dental Websites: HIPAA impends big. Prevent dumping safeguarded health information right into non-compliant devices. For basic marketing, use a CRM for non-PHI signals, such as name, email, and consultation requests that remain high degree. For scheduling, incorporate with a compliant practice monitoring system like Dentrix or EagleSoft using a secure scheduling widget as opposed to full information sync. Sector campaigns by procedure rate of interest and recall day, and maintain PHI on certified systems. Numerous techniques succeed with a marketing-friendly CRM like ActiveCampaign for tip nudges, yet they silo medical details to stay compliant.
  • Home Care Agency Internet sites: Conformity and caregiver scheduling drive the pile. CRMs like HubSpot or Zoho can take care of household queries and support circulations, however keep care strategies and clinical notes in a HIPAA-compliant system. A WordPress inquiry kind should send out a non-PHI recap to the CRM and an encrypted note to intake. SMS is practical for caregiver accessibility checks, but once more, no PHI in common CRMs.
  • Legal Internet sites: Consumption types require dispute checks and accurate phone call tracking. Regulation practice CRMs such as Clio Grow integrate well through Zapier or indigenous adapters. Link WordPress create entries to consumption jobs and standing updates. Usage phone tracking numbers for each campaign and push the keyword/ad group information to the issue's initial contact record.
  • Real Estate Site: Home alerts and pipe velocity matter more than anything. Follow Up Employer, LionDesk, or HubSpot with a real estate schema work well. Integrate IDX search on WordPress and pass building interests to the CRM so you can cause targeted alerts. Rate to lead is everything in this category. Add text and rounded robin to lower lead decay.
  • Restaurant/ Regional Retail Sites: Lighter weight. The CRM commonly appears like a customer data system plus email/SMS commitment. WooCommerce shops should pass purchase data to Klaviyo or Mailchimp. For restaurants, an appointment combination (Tock, Resy, OpenTable) coupled with a marketing CRM for loyalty campaigns is enough. Focus on list development and redemption monitoring rather than a full sales pipeline.
  • Medical/ Med Health facility Internet sites: This space straddles HIPAA worry about aggressive advertising objectives. If you're not taking care of PHI in your CRM, advertising and marketing tools like HubSpot or ActiveCampaign execute well, paired with an organizing system that doesn't subject sensitive information. Sector by therapy passion and readiness. Before-and-after galleries are conversion gold however need to be maximized for speed.

When stakeholders listen to "assimilation," they envision a big-bang project. In method, one of the most successful Quincy rollouts start lean. Wire up forms and basic deal monitoring, then add automations as the group expands comfortable. I recommend a 60 to 90 day stablizing duration prior to layering innovative division and scoring.

Anatomy of a reputable WordPress-to-CRM integration

Form submissions are the backbone. If your site uses Gravity Forms, WPForms, or Ninja Kinds, utilize their native CRM attachments where feasible. They have a tendency to be much more durable than common webhooks. If you're utilizing Elementor or a headless WordPress develop, test the webhook haul meticulously. I've captured quiet failures from missing out on nonces or third-party caching that obstructs article requests.

Map the fields attentively. Do not put whatever right into a free-text note. Produce structured areas for service location, spending plan band, favored appointment window, and referral source. For multi-location businesses, capture place or ZIP code to steer automations. Include concealed fields to track UTM parameters and last-click source. This information enhances acknowledgment and lets you trim ad spend.

For authentication and safety, use OAuth connections or API secrets saved in setting variables, not in the WordPress choices table. Rate-limit kind endpoints and allow spam filters that do not damage accessibility. Honeypots can assist, but reCAPTCHA v3 tuned to a reasonable threshold stays clear of obstructing genuine customers on older devices.

Don't overlook webhooks from the CRM back to WordPress. When a deal strikes "Won," you could trigger a thank-you page customization, a testimonial demand component, or a task portal login. Keep external telephone calls async and cache feedbacks to prevent slowing page loads.

Speed and stability maintain conversions alive

I've acquired websites that look lovely but sink conversions with 4 second time to interactive. On a 4G connection around Quincy, you require to strike the first make quick or you shed mobile site visitors. A tidy theme, marginal manuscripts, and picture technique are non-negotiable. If you run ads, you're paying for every lagging second.

A couple of habits pay swiftly. Serve WebP photos with receptive dimensions, maintain CSS under control by pruning page contractor bloat, and defer unimportant manuscripts. If you embed CRM chat or monitoring, lazy-load it after customer interaction or below the fold. Utilize a web content delivery connect with a side cache tuned for WordPress. I've seen 30 to 50 percent decreases in server action time after setting up caching layers properly. These optimizations dovetail with web site upkeep strategies since plugins and CRMs develop, and a fast website in March can end up being a slug by July if you overlook updates and script creep.

Data you can trust, and data you can act on

Messy information silently deteriorates ROI. If telephone number show up with various styles, you wind up with duplicate calls. If personnel free-type lead sources, your reports lose value. Construct validation into kinds: dropdowns for services, concealed phone fields, e-mail verification, and clear mistake messages that do not irritate site visitors. Standardize fields inside the CRM, not only on WordPress. When the site passes a solution kind of "Roofing Repair work" and one associate changes it to "Repair service," you welcome disorder down the road.

Scoring leads is helpful when done sparingly. A Quincy med medical spa may give points for viewing a pricing web page, downloading a pre-care overview, and connecting with a consultation type. A roofer could consider postal code influenced by storm events and repeat visits to insurance case content. Prevent black-box scores that your group can not discuss. If an associate can't tell why a lead is "hot," they will not rely on it.

Attribution isn't ideal, however it needs to suffice to direct spending plan. Use a first-touch and last-touch design side by side, then consider assisted conversions. Tiny example dimensions can misguide. Many regional organizations do not require multichannel enterprise tools. Clean UTM self-control and a stable Google Analytics 4 arrangement with server-side tagging for type occasions often deliver the clearness you need.

The Quincy lens: area patterns and practical constraints

Patterns emerge when you work with local traffic. Lunch break searching on mobile is genuine for Restaurant/ Local Retail Websites. Late-night research spikes for Lawful Websites and Home Care Company Site where families talk about choices after youngsters are asleep. Weekend break rises hit Specialist/ Roof covering Sites after storms or the very first thaw. CRM operations ought to show this.

For instance, we set up a round robin for a Quincy roofer that weights weekend break brings about on-call employee, with SMS motivates if a lead sits untouched for 10 minutes. Action prices improved by 20 to 30 percent, and appointment booking climbed within the initial month. A dental method added a soft "Request Appointment" widget on mobile that requires 3 faucets, not nine. The CRM logs these as "Demands" and activates admin follow-up throughout service hours, while a HIPAA-compliant system handles actual visit information. No PHI goes across into the advertising and marketing system.

Real estate groups gain from micro-segmentation. If a customer views 3 listings in Quincy Center in between 700k and 900k, the CRM tags them with a focused cost band and area rate of interest. The weekly e-mail reveals new listings within that band, not a generic Greater Boston absorb. When the regular email appeals Thursday early morning, click-through rates stay high due to the fact that it reflects exactly what the user had in mind.

Custom Internet site Design that values the CRM

A custom-made internet site design can look smooth and still play perfectly with your CRM. The method is to design types and interactive elements with clear information Hand-offs from the beginning. Modals, multi-step types, and conversational user interfaces can increase conversions, however each step should convert into clean areas. If the design calls for image-heavy galleries or parallax results, we strangle those on mobile and maintain form web pages ultralight.

Be skeptical of uniqueness for novelty's benefit. A med health club once had a sparkling hero video that pushed the appointment form listed below the fold on iPhones. After we replaced the video with an image and pulled the type right into the viewport, conversion lift offset whatever aesthetic compromise we made. Design ought to serve lead capture and user clarity. It's not either/or.

The functional layer: Site Maintenance Plans that protect the pipeline

Integrations don't stay healthy and balanced on auto-pilot. API versions change, plugins launch protection patches, and CRMs roll out brand-new items or price limitations. An upkeep strategy is not just back-ups and plugin updates. It includes combination monitoring, form submission screening, and routine reconciliation of area mappings. I like to arrange month-to-month examination submissions for key forms and spot-check CRM documents to capture drift early.

Even tiny details issue. If your CRM adds an anti-spam filter that flags "examination" entries, and your team utilizes "test" throughout training, you'll think the type is damaged. Documenting these peculiarities inside your upkeep plan conserves hours of head-scratching later.

Local search engine optimization Internet site Setup meets CRM discipline

Local SEO drives the top of the funnel, yet the CRM identifies how much of that traffic transforms. Build area web pages that line up with your services and service areas, pair them with kinds that label the community or ZIP, and carry that metadata right into the CRM. When you see that Wollaston is converting at twice the rate of Merrymount for a specific service, you can fine-tune landing pages and ad budgets.

Schema markup for services and testimonials aids, however it needs to fill easily and not introduce render-blocking scripts. Tie testimonial demands to a "Won" stage in the CRM, distributing them throughout Google, Yelp, and industry-specific platforms to prevent patterns that cause filters. For dental and med health facility websites, equilibrium review outreach with system guidelines to remain compliant.

Security and conformity: sensible guardrails

It's alluring to shuttle bus every data factor right into your CRM. Resist need when it risks compliance. For oral, clinical, and some lawful contexts, route delicate material with HIPAA-compliant forms or sites. Use security en route and rest for sensitive systems and keep advertising CRM information restricted to non-PHI. On WordPress, harden forms and restrict who can see submissions inside the admin. For any website, path back-ups to safeguard storage and edit sensitive fields.

Audit customer access quarterly. I have actually seen former employees still holding CRM or WordPress qualifications months after leaving. That's a hole waiting to be exploited.

A basic plan for getting started

Here is a succinct series that works well for many Quincy companies tackling CRM and WordPress integration for the very first time:

  • Define a couple of core objectives: quicker reaction to inbound leads, higher scheduling rates, or much better attribution. Keep it specific.
  • Choose a CRM that fits your upright: prioritize native WordPress ports and group use over function sprawl.
  • Map areas with discipline: maintain structured areas for service kinds, area, and resource; include hidden UTM fields.
  • Build and test forms: make use of a reliable type plugin with an indigenous CRM add-on; confirm, sterilize, and imitate actual traffic.
  • Roll out crucial automations: instantaneous notifications, replicate checks, and a standard nurture sequence; save advanced workflows for after the group settles in.

Most businesses can complete this plan within 3 to 6 weeks, then expand towards innovative division, SMS, and reporting when the fundamentals hold constant for a month or two.

Case patterns from the field

A Quincy roof covering company purchased ads after a windstorm but lost leads over night because their site buffered for 6 seconds on mobile. We reconstructed the landing web page with a lean motif, compressed media, and postponed hefty scripts. We attached Gravity Types directly to HubSpot with pipe mapping and SMS validate. Cost per booked assessment stopped by roughly 28 percent, mainly due to the fact that the form completion price doubled.

An oral method desired online booking inside WordPress. After assessing HIPAA advice and supplier capabilities, we shifted to a safe and secure reservation widget that deals with PHI off-site. The marketing CRM captures intent and follow-up preference, not medical history. Their no-show rate dropped after we added a calibrated two-step reminder series, and conformity stayed clean.

A tiny real estate group relied on a get in touch with kind that emailed agents straight. Leads died in inboxes. We transferred to a Lead Capture kind connected to Adhere to Up Boss, turned on rounded robin task, and produced a mobile-first residential property alert registration. Within 2 months, the typical time-to-first-touch fell under 10 mins during company hours, and the pipe completed with precise rate bands.
